What kind of organisms can remove nitrogen from the atmosphere?

Certain types of bacteria, known as nitrogen-fixing bacteria, have the ability to convert atmospheric nitrogen gas (N2) into a form that can be used by plants and other organisms. These bacteria form symbiotic relationships with leguminous plants, such as peas and beans, and help them to absorb nitrogen from the air.


What is the name of the bacteria which increase the fertility of soil?

The name of the bacteria that increase soil fertility is Rhizobium. These bacteria form symbiotic relationships with leguminous plants, such as peas and beans, by fixing nitrogen from the atmosphere into a form that the plants can use for growth.

If nearly 79 of the atmosphere is made of nitrogen how could there be a shortage of nitrogen in soil?

Although the atmosphere is rich in nitrogen gas, plants cannot use this form directly. Nitrogen needs to be converted into a usable form like nitrates by soil bacteria for plants to uptake. In cases where the soil lacks these nitrogen-fixing bacteria or has been depleted due to overfarming, there can be a shortage of available nitrogen for plants.

What gas makes up 78 percent of your atmosphere but can be used by plants only when transformed by bacteria first?

Nitrogen. The bacterial transformation is needed to break the triple bonds of diatomic atmospheric nitrogen, something plants can't do, so these bacteria fix the nitrogen into a usable form in exchange for plant sugar

In the nitrogen cyclebacteria fix nitrogen from the atmosphere to form?

In the nitrogen cycle, bacteria fix nitrogen from the atmosphere to form ammonia. This ammonia can then be converted into nitrites and nitrates by other bacteria in the soil, which plants can absorb to use for growth. Nitrogen eventually returns to the atmosphere through denitrification by bacteria.


When there is not enough nitrogen in the atmosphere for plants how do the plants get it?

Plants do not actually get their nitrogen from the atmosphere. They get it in compounds in the soil through their roots. Some plants form symbiotic relationships with bacteria in the soil. The bacteria draw nitrogen from the air and form nitrogen compounds. The plants can then use the nitrogen.

Why is rhizobi a helpful bacteria?

Rhizobia are known as nitrogen fixation bacteria. Nitrogen is an essential element for plants and it is plentiful in the atmosphere but in a form that is inaccessible to plants. Rhizobia can convert atmospheric nitrogen into a form that plants can uptake through their roots.

How does nitrogen get from organisms back into the atmosphere?

Nitrogen is returned to the atmosphere through the process of denitrification, where bacteria convert nitrates in the soil back into nitrogen gas. This process completes the nitrogen cycle as nitrogen is released back into the atmosphere as a gas.
